The books are identical - it's only the cover art that's different. The reason for the "adult editions" was simply that the books proved so amazingly popular with adults that the publisher brought out new editions with covers that didn't make it look as though it was a children's book, to encourage adult sales. If I recall correctly, the "adult editions" came out after about the 3rd or 4th book in the series. Certainly the last three books were released with "adult" and "juvenile" covers simultaneously.
